Summary


In this episode, Matt and Matt discuss various questions from Reddit related to pride, eclipses, churches compromising for popularity, and same-sex marriages. They emphasize the importance of understanding the context of pride as a sin and the dangers of idolatrous pride. They also address the significance of eclipses and debunk the idea of them being prophetic events. Regarding churches compromising for popularity, they highlight the need for churches to stay true to God's word and not condone sin. They also discuss the complexities of divorce and same-sex marriages within Christian churches.
